The General Data Protection Regulation (GDPR) is the most comprehensive data privacy law in the world, affecting any organization that processes personal data of EU residents.
Enacted in May 2018, GDPR sets strict requirements for data collection, processing, storage, and transfer. Non-compliance can lead to fines of up to €20 million or 4% of global annual turnover, whichever is higher.
Beyond compliance, GDPR represents an opportunity to strengthen customer trust, improve data governance, and build a competitive advantage through responsible data practices.

Organizations face multiple obstacles in achieving and maintaining GDPR compliance
Identifying all personal data across complex IT environments, "Shadow IT," and legacy systems remains a major challenge for most organizations.
Managing vendor relationships and ensuring processors comply with GDPR standards requires continuous assessments and contractual safeguards.
Meeting strict deadlines for data subject requests (30 days) and breach notifications (72 hours) requires robust processes and automation.
